Start of Term Information for Faculty 

Upcoming Dates for the Harvard College Fall 2025 Semester: 

  • August 12–14, 2025
    • Incoming student registration
  • Thursday, August 14, 2025 at 11:59 pm
    Incoming students course registration deadline
  • August 25–September 9, 2025
    • Add/drop period
  • Tuesday, September 2, 2025
    • Fall Term begins. First meeting of fall term classes.
  • December 3, 2025
    • Last meeting of fall term classes.

    Derek Bok Center for Teaching and Learning


    The OUE partners with the Derek Bok Center for Teaching and Learning on several initiatives, including the Pedagogy Fellows Program, teaching conferences, and the Certificates of Distinction in Teaching for Teaching Fellows. We invite faculty and graduate students who are interested in strengthening their teaching skills and courses to explore the many offerings of the Bok Center.

    Mindich Program in Engaged Scholarship


    The Mindich Program in Engaged Scholarship (MPES) supports innovations in teaching and learning through civically engaged experiential learning in or with community beyond the Harvard context. The Engaged Scholarship website offers resources to teaching staff, course fellows, and students to support the pursuit of engaged coursework and research.
